​LONDON — In a dramatic morning address outside the black door of 10 Downing Street, Prime Minister Sir Keir Starmer announced his resignation as leader of the governing Labour Party, prematurely ending his tenure just two years after a historic landslide victory.

​The announcement triggers the departure of yet another British leader, making Starmer the sixth prime minister in a decade to announce a premature exit from office. Starmer confirmed he will remain in place as a caretaker prime minister until a successor is chosen, with the party aiming to conclude the leadership transition before Parliament returns from summer recess in September.

​The Breaking Point: The Burnham Factor

​The momentum against Starmer shifted decisively over the weekend following Thursday’s Makerfield by-election. Former Greater Manchester Mayor Andy Burnham secured a decisive victory over Reform UK, paving his way back to Westminster. Burnham’s successful resistance against Nigel Farage’s populist right party was viewed by a panicked parliamentary party as proof that he is better positioned to defend Labour’s thinning margins.

​Starmer spent a tense weekend at the Prime Minister’s Chequers country estate consulting with his family and inner circle. This followed warnings from more than half a dozen cabinet ministers that his leadership was no longer tenable.

​Speaking to a crowded street of journalists, Starmer addressed the intense intraparty pressure head-on:

​“The question my party is asking now is whether I am best placed to lead us into the next general election. I have heard the answer of my parliamentary party to that question, and I accept that answer with good grace. Every decision I have taken has been about putting the country I love first.”

​Two Years of Turmoil

​While Starmer entered Downing Street in July 2024 on a wave of optimism that ended 14 years of Conservative rule, his administration quickly became mired in economic headwinds and domestic controversy.

​Despite inheriting what he described as a “politically, financially, and morally bankrupt” party and steering it to a landslide, Starmer’s personal approval ratings recently plummeted to historic lows, with a June poll revealing that 74% of UK adults believed he was doing “badly.”

​A series of political vulnerability points accelerated his decline:

  • ​Economic Stagnation: Persistent difficulties in kickstarting economic growth and alleviating the cost-of-living crisis.
  • ​Policy Reversals: Highly unpopular decisions, including the controversial cutting of the winter fuel allowance for pensioners.
  • ​Electoral Wipeouts: Devastating local and regional elections in May that saw Labour lose 38 councils in England and suffer near-total elimination in Wales.
  • ​Diplomatic Backlash: Widespread internal anger regarding the appointment of Peter Mandelson as the UK Ambassador to the United States.

​International reactions arrived quickly following the speech. US President Donald Trump commented on social media, linking Starmer’s exit to policy friction over energy production and immigration, adding that Starmer had “failed badly” on those issues. Relations between the two leaders had soured in recent months, exacerbated by the UK’s decision not to join the US in the ongoing Iran conflict.

​What Happens Next?

​The race to succeed Starmer begins immediately. Because any challenger requires 81 nominations from Labour lawmakers to trigger a formal ballot, party figures are working behind the scenes to determine if a full, prolonged leadership race will occur or if the party will move toward a swift coronation.

Financial markets reacted swiftly to the political vacuum. Shortly after signs of an imminent statement emerged from Downing Street, yields on 10-year UK government bonds climbed to 4.86%, while the British pound dipped below $1.32, illustrating investor anxiety over Britain’s continued political volatility.​Reflecting on his journey, an emotional Starmer concluded his speech by acknowledging the historical weight of his brief tenure. “Walking up this street two years ago was the proudest moment of my life,” he said. “We proved people wrong because we changed our party… becoming a party that once again stood proudly with, not against, our national flag.”
